What is Fulvic Acid Powder?

Fulvic acid is a nutrient-dense, yellow-colored compound that forms when organic plant matter breaks down over time. It typically occurs along with humic acids, which together comprise a major component of humus, the organic fraction of soil and sediments (1). Compared to humic acid, fulvic acid particles are substantially smaller in size, allowing for greater bioavailability and absorption in the body (2). As an antioxidant and free radical scavenger, fulvic acid helps neutralize cell-damaging compounds and control inflammation (3). It also enhances the availability of nutrients by boosting their ability to pass through cell membranes (4). These unique properties have prompted investigation into fulvic acid's therapeutic effects.

Scientific Studies on Fulvic Acid Powder Benefits

Early studies have uncovered promising health applications of fulvic acid powder. One animal trial found that fulvic acid combats free radical activity and protects against LPS-induced liver damage in rats (5). A recent 2020 report observed powerful antioxidant, antimicrobial, anti-inflammatory, neuroprotective, and immunoprotective effects in cell-based assays, possibly due to fulvic acid's influence on signaling pathways (6). Clinical research also showed improved self-rated health scores, immune markers, and gut microbiota diversity in adults consuming fulvic acid daily for 45 days (7). While human trials remain limited overall, the existing scientific evidence supports fulvic acid's multifaceted biological impacts. Further investigations could uncover additional therapeutic mechanisms.

Potential Health Benefits of Fulvic Acid Powder

The unique structure and antioxidant activity of fulvic acid may offer wide-ranging advantages, from enhanced nutrient absorption to immune system support. As an electrolyte, fulvic acid helps carry nutrients across membranes to increase bioavailability (8). It also boosts enzymes and healthy gut flora levels while protecting gut barrier integrity against pathogens and toxins (9). These effects likely contribute to fulvic acid's capacity to heighten immune function (10) while moderating inflammation pathways that drive chronic illness (11). Additionally, preliminary research found that fulvic acid enhances focus, alertness, and information processing speed, indicating nootropic-like cognitive benefits (12). By neutralizing free radicals, fulvic acid further helps renew cells, preserve organ function, and slow the aging process.

Ways to Use Fulvic Acid Powder

Fulvic acid powder offers flexibility in usage as a daily supplement or topical treatment. Many take fulvic acid powder capsules, with common dosage recommendations ranging from 100-500 mg daily (13). Combining the powder with juice, shakes, or smoothies can help mask its bitter taste. As a water-soluble compound, fulvic acid also diffuses easily for use in skin serums, gels, and creams. Topical preparations show potential for healing wounds, soothing eczema, and reducing signs of aging (14). Those using prescription medications should consult their healthcare provider before using fulvic acid supplements due to possible interactions. When purchasing any commercial fulvic acid product, vetting the purity and quality is critical.

Potential Side Effects and Precautions

Currently, fulvic acid powder is considered safe for healthy adults, with mild side effects like headaches or nausea typically resolving quickly (15). However rare allergic reactions can occur. High doses may also interact with certain medications. Any pre-existing conditions, especially gut disorders like ulcers, warrant caution with use due to possible stomach irritation (16). Those who are pregnant, nursing, or administering fulvic acid powder to children should first consult their physician. Keep fulvic acid powder locked away securely since its yellow color and powder form may appear intentionally misleading to kids. Monitoring personal tolerance while carefully following all supplement label instructions can help maintain safety with use.
